Why Beard Care Matters
Your beard protects your face, but it also faces daily challenges from weather, grooming, sweat, and product buildup. Without a consistent routine, both your beard and the skin underneath can become dry, uncomfortable, and difficult to manage.
A proper beard care routine can help:
- Reduce dryness and irritation
- Minimize beard itch
- Support healthy-looking skin beneath the beard
- Soften coarse facial hair
- Improve manageability
- Reduce breakage
- Promote a fuller, healthier-looking beard
Healthy skin is the foundation of a healthy beard.

Common Beard Concerns
My beard is itchy.
Dry skin is often the cause of beard itch.
Hydrate with Beard Butter, then apply Beard Oil to help seal in that moisture.
My beard feels dry and coarse.
Use Beard Butter daily to restore moisture and Beard Oil to help maintain softness throughout the day.
I have beard flakes.
Dry skin beneath the beard can lead to flaking.
Keep the skin clean with Beard Cleanse, moisturize with Beard Butter, and finish with Beard Oil to help reduce moisture loss.
My beard is difficult to manage.
A hydrated beard is easier to comb, shape, and maintain.

Beard Care Tips
- Cleanse your beard regularly to remove buildup.
- Moisturize the skin beneath your beard—not just the beard itself.
- Apply Beard Butter first to replenish moisture.
- Follow with Beard Oil to help seal in moisture and condition the beard.
- Comb daily to distribute products evenly.
- Stay hydrated by drinking plenty of water.
- Consistency delivers the best results.
Frequently Asked Questions
How often should I wash my beard?
Most beards benefit from cleansing 2–3 times per week, or more often if you're active or use styling products regularly.
Why should I use Beard Butter before Beard Oil?
Beard Butter contains moisturizing ingredients like aloe vera and glycerin that help replenish moisture. Beard Oil is then applied to help seal in that moisture while conditioning the beard.
